The Design Factors Affecting Unfolding

Material and Construction

The material of the fire blanket plays a huge role in how easy it is to unfold. Most car fire blankets are made from fiberglass or other fire - resistant fabrics. Fiberglass is a great choice because it's lightweight and has excellent fire - retardant properties. However, if the fiberglass is too thick or the weave is too tight, it can make the blanket a bit stiff and difficult to unfold quickly.

Some manufacturers use a special treatment on the fabric to make it more flexible. This can include adding a small amount of silicone or other softening agents. These treatments can significantly improve the ease of unfolding. For example, a well - treated fiberglass blanket will feel more like a regular blanket and can be opened up with just a quick tug.

The way the blanket is constructed also matters. A blanket that is folded neatly and has clear fold lines is much easier to unfold than one that's been haphazardly stuffed into a storage bag. Some Car Fire Blankets come with a special folding pattern that allows them to unfold in a single, smooth motion. This is a really smart design because it can save you precious seconds in an emergency.

Storage and Packaging

How the Car Fire Blanket is stored and packaged can have a big impact on its unfoldability. If the blanket is stored in a tight, cramped space for a long time, it can become compressed and hard to open. That's why many of our Car Fire Blankets come with a specially designed storage pouch.

These pouches are made to keep the blanket in a proper folded state and also allow for easy access. They often have a rip - open feature or a quick - release mechanism. For instance, some pouches have a Velcro strip that can be easily torn off, allowing you to grab the blanket and start unfolding it right away.

On the other hand, if you just throw the blanket into the glove box or under the seat without any proper packaging, it can get all bunched up and tangled. This can make it extremely difficult to unfold when you really need it.

Comparing with Other Fire Blankets

Let's take a look at how Car Fire Blankets compare with other types of fire blankets, like Fireproof Blankets and Welding Blankets.

Fireproof Blankets are usually used in homes and offices. They are often larger in size and may be made from different materials. While they are also designed to be easy to unfold, they may not have the same level of compactness and quick - access features as Car Fire Blankets. For example, a home fireproof blanket might be stored in a closet, and it could take a few extra seconds to find and unfold it.

Welding Blankets, on the other hand, are used in industrial settings. They are typically much thicker and heavier than Car Fire Blankets because they need to protect against extremely high temperatures and sparks. Unfolding a welding blanket can be a bit of a chore, especially if it's been rolled up tightly for a long time. In contrast, Car Fire Blankets are designed to be lightweight and easy to handle, making them much easier to unfold in a hurry.

Tips for Easy Unfolding

If you're a car owner with a Car Fire Blanket, here are some tips to make sure it's easy to unfold when you need it:

  • Store it properly: Use the storage pouch that comes with the blanket and keep it in a place where you can easily reach it, like the door pocket or under the driver's seat.
  • Practice unfolding: Take a few minutes every once in a while to practice unfolding the blanket. This will help you get familiar with how it works and build muscle memory.
  • Check for damage: Regularly inspect the blanket for any signs of damage, such as tears or fraying. A damaged blanket may be more difficult to unfold and may not work as effectively.
